Understanding How Google Ranks ‘Near Me’ Results

To appear for “near me” searches, your business must send strong local signals to Google. The algorithm relies on three main factors:

  1. Relevance – How closely your business matches what the searcher wants.

  2. Distance – How close your location is to the person searching.

  3. Prominence – How well-known or trusted your business appears online.

Let’s look at how you can improve each of these to climb higher in Toronto’s local results.

Step 1: Optimize Your Google Business Profile

Your Google Business Profile (GBP) — previously Google My Business — is the backbone of your Local SEO Toronto strategy.

Complete Every Detail

Google favors listings that are complete and accurate. Make sure you’ve filled out:

  • Business name, address, and phone number (exactly as shown on your website)

  • Category (e.g., “Bakery,” “Dental Clinic,” “Digital Marketing Agency”)

  • Hours of operation

  • Website URL

  • Description with your main keyword, such as “Providing expert SEO Toronto services since 2015”

Upload High-Quality Photos

Add professional images of your location, products, and team. Listings with photos receive significantly more clicks and calls than those without.

Collect and Respond to Reviews

Customer reviews are one of the most important local ranking factors. Encourage happy customers to leave reviews and respond to every single one — both positive and negative — with gratitude and professionalism.

Step 3: Strengthen Your On-Page SEO

Your website must communicate trust, location, and relevance clearly to Google and your visitors.

Add Your Business Address and Map

Include your full business address on your Contact page and embed a Google Map pointing to your location.

Use Local Schema Markup

Add Local Business Schema to your website’s code. This helps Google understand your exact address, services, and reviews — improving your chance of appearing in rich results and map packs.

Optimize Meta Tags and Headings

Use your target keyword seo toronto in meta titles, descriptions, and H1 headings naturally. For example:

  • Title: “Local SEO Toronto Experts Helping Businesses Rank for ‘Near Me’ Searches”

  • Meta Description: “Learn how to rank higher on Google Maps and local results with SEO Toronto techniques built for small businesses.”

Step 5: Build Consistent NAP Citations

NAP (Name, Address, Phone Number) consistency is key in local SEO. Google cross-checks your business information across the web.

Where to Add Your Business

List your company on reputable directories such as:

  • YellowPages.ca

  • 411.ca

  • CanadaOne

  • Yelp

  • Bing Places for Business

Make sure your details match exactly on every platform — even punctuation and abbreviations matter.

Step 7: Focus on Mobile Optimization

Most “near me” searches happen on smartphones. If your website isn’t mobile-friendly, you’ll lose visitors fast.

What to Optimize

  • Ensure quick loading times (under 3 seconds).

  • Make buttons and forms easy to tap.

  • Display your phone number as a clickable link for instant calls.

A fast, mobile-optimized site improves rankings and helps customers act immediately.

Step 8: Track and Measure Your Local SEO Performance

SEO is not a one-time setup — it’s an ongoing process.

Use These Tools to Track Results

  • Google Business Insights: See how many people view and interact with your listing.

  • Google Analytics: Track website visitors and conversions.

  • Google Search Console: Monitor keywords and fix technical issues.

  • Local Rank Trackers: Use BrightLocal or Semrush to check your position in Toronto’s “near me” results.

Analyze your performance monthly and refine strategies based on real data.
